How do you solve this basic math problem? Could someone please explain step by step?

10+2*(5+20/2*5)-2*2/2*2= ? (the result should be 116)

I don't know what am I doing wrong. Everytime I try to solve this problem I get the answer 69 and not 116. Can someone please explain step by step how you should calculate in order to get to the correct answer?( 116)

    Brackets first

    (5+20/2*5)

    Then division is first.

    20/2 =10

    10*5 =50

    5+50=55

    2*55 =110

    10+110=120

    Now on the other side of the minus sign. There is both multiplication and division. Since you did division first on the left, do division first.

    2/2 =1

    2*1*2 =4

    Therefore 120-4 = 116

    10 + 2*(5 + 20/2*5) - 2*2/2*2

    Do the divisions first

    = 10 + 2*(5 + 10*5) - 2*1*2

    = 10 + 2*(5 + 50) - 4

    = 10 + 2*(55) - 4

    = 10 + 110 - 4

    = 116
